Chartres Cathedral,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, is located in:

A) France
B) Italy
C) Spain
D) Portugal

Correct Answer: A) France

The Cathédrale Notre-Dame de Chartres, located in Chartres, France, is a Roman Catholic church considered one of the finest examples of French Gothic architecture. Its exceptional state of preservation and famous stained glass windows make it a UNESCO World Heritage Site.
